C.K.O.D. Generation
Originally released in 2004. C.K.O.D. Generation is a documentary film. directed by Piotr Szczepański. At just 57 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Synopsis
For two years, the director traveled wherever the members of the Cool Kids Of Death band appeared. He used a camera to record fragments of concerts, interviews, heavy drinking parties and obscene conversations held backstage, so it's no wonder that he became friends with the musicians. However, the true measure of this friendship turns out to be his film, in which Szczepanski escapes both the temptation to make a joke about his friends and a harsh lampoon.
